Preoperative precautions:

1. It is best to insert the IUD 3 to 7 days after the menstruation ends. Because this period is a safe period, the endometrium has just begun to form and the possibility of pregnancy is small; therefore, it is possible to avoid having an IUD inserted during pregnancy, which may cause uterine bleeding or miscarriage.

2. The best time to insert the IUD is when the uterus has returned to normal 6 weeks after delivery. Also, the best time to insert the IUD is within 7 days after normal menstruation after a miscarriage. For those who are in good condition six months after a cesarean section, the IUD can be inserted after the placenta is delivered. For emergency contraception, the IUD is inserted within 5 days after unprotected intercourse.

3. Patients with acute or chronic pelvic inflammatory disease, vaginitis, and sexually transmitted diseases should not have the IUD inserted. They should wait until they are cured and choose the right time to have the IUD inserted according to the doctor's advice. This is the most critical point to note before having the IUD inserted.

2. Postoperative precautions:

1. Side effects that may occur after the release of the ring. If the menstrual volume increases significantly after the IUD is placed, the menstrual period is significantly prolonged, or there is frequent small amount of bleeding, or there is severe lower back pain or abdominal pain, these are all abnormal phenomena and you should go to the hospital for examination.

2. Check regularly. Generally, the first check-up after the placement of the ring is after the first menstruation, the second check-up is within 3-6 months after the placement of the ring, and the third check-up is 12 months after the placement of the ring, and then it is checked once a year.
